The AD974 is a 4-channel, 200 ksps, low power 16-bit A/D converter that operates from a single 5 V supply. It contains a four-channel input multiplexer, a successive-approximation switched-capacitor ADC, an internal 2.5 V reference, and a high-speed serial interface. The AD974 dissipates a maximum of 120 mW, and has a powerdown mode. The ADC is factory calibrated to minimize all linearity errors. The AD974 is specified for full-scale bipolar input ranges of ±10 V, 0 V to 5 V and 0 V to 4 V. The AD974 is comprehensively tested for ac parameters such as SNR and THD, as well as the more traditional dc parameters of offset, gain and linearity. The AD974 is available in skinny 28-pin DIP, SOIC, and SSOP packages.
